I have a problem with the certificate for Zarafa and owncloud the problem is that the ssl certificate has expired 29 dec last year. When i logon to the managment page the certificate is ok and expires 2024.So the question is how to i renew it for the apps.
I know when the heartbleed problem was announced i removed my certs and created new ones and all was fine even with my Zarafa app and management page. After this the only thing i have done is to install the os updates and owncloud but on the other hand i have not checked the ssl certificates lately so i have no clue when it happend.
This is what i have done to try and fixe it
1. Deleted my ca-cert.pem and sys-0-cert.pem and created new ones from the webinterface. This solved the expire date of the ssl cert for the management page of Clearos but not for the apps Zarafa and owncloud.
2. restarted the server. Still saying that the certificate is out of date
3. searched the forums but I was not able to find any information on how to solve the SSL certificate problems for the apps that i have installed from the marketplace.
System info
Version ClearOS Community release 6.5.0 (Final)
Kernel Version 2.6.32-431.17.1.v6.x86_64
CPU Model Intel(R) Xeon(R) CPU E5345 @ 2.33GHz
Memory Size 15.57 GB
